Preheat the oven to 350F.
-
2
Warm 2 tablespoons of the olive oil in a saute pan over medium heat and add the pancetta.
-
3
Cook until some of the fat renders, about 4 minutes.
-
4
Add the carrot, celery, and garlic and saute until tender but not colored, 3 to 4 minutes.
-
5
Add the kale and saute until just wilted, about 1 minute.
-
6
Add the chicken stock and cook down until the liquid nearly evaporates and the mixture is thick, 3 to 4 minutes.
-
7
Place the mixture in a large bowl with the bread cubes and toss to mix.
-
8
Season to taste with salt and pepper.
-
9
Add the sage and additional olive oil if necessary to moisten.
-
10
Allow the mixture to cool before stuffing the birds.
-
11
Season each quail on both sides with salt and pepper.
-
12
Pack the quail as tightly as possible, using about 1 cup of stuffing per bird.
-
13
Tuck the wings under the bird behind the back.
-
14
Bend one drumstick across the cavity opening, keeping the stuffing in place.
-
15
Secure by tucking the tip under the skin.
-
16
Cross the other drumstick over it so that the quail looks like its doing yoga.
-
17
Tear off about 5 inches of foil.
-
18
Fold the long end up about 1 inch, crease, then keep folding and creasing until you have a reinforced band 1 inch tall and as long as your box of foil.
-
19
Wrap the band around the quail to secure, twisting the ends.
-
20
Trim off extra foil with scissors.
-
21
Make 3 more bands the same way and repeat with the remaining birds.
-
22
Divide the remaining 2 tablespoons olive oil between two 10-inch ovenproof saute pans, and warm over high heat.
-
23
Brown the quail on each side, about 1 minute each, including the foil-wrapped sides.
-
24
Once you turn the quail to brown the top, top each with 1 teaspoon butter and put the pans in the oven.
-
25
After 5 minutes, turn each quail so that the top of the bird is up.
-
26
Roast for 5 minutes longer, or until a metal skewer inserted into the middle of the stuffing feels warm against your lip.
-
27
Once the quail are done, transfer to a board and remove the foil.
-
28
Return to the pan to crisp the skin and brown the sides that were under the foil strips.
-
29
Serve.
